Ingredients
- 2 pounds boneless chicken thighs or breasts
- 8 small flour tortillas
- 2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
- ½ cup honey BBQ sauce
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 2 garlic cloves, minced
- 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- ½ teaspoon black pepper
- ½ teaspoon salt
- ½ cup crumbled blue cheese
- 2 tablespoons chopped parsley
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
Instructions
Step 1
Season the chicken with smoked paprika, onion powder, salt, and black pepper.
Step 2
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Cook the chicken for about 6–7 minutes per side until fully cooked.
Step 3
Remove the chicken and shred it using two forks.
Step 4
In the same skillet, melt the butter and sauté the minced garlic for one minute.
Step 5
Add the shredded chicken back into the skillet. Pour in the honey BBQ sauce and stir until the chicken is fully coated.
Step 6
Warm the tortillas in a skillet or microwave until soft.
Step 7
Fill each tortilla with shredded mozzarella cheese followed by the honey BBQ chicken.
Step 8
Top with more melted cheese, crumbled blue cheese, and chopped parsley.
Step 9
Serve immediately with extra BBQ sauce, ranch dressing, or your favorite dipping sauce.
Recipe Tips
- Use chicken thighs for extra juicy tacos.
- Warm tortillas before serving to prevent cracking.
- Add jalapeños for extra heat.
- Grill the tacos for 2 minutes after assembling for crispy edges.
- Fresh parsley adds color and freshness.
Storage
Store leftover chicken in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 4 days. Reheat gently before serving. Tortillas are best stored separately to keep them fresh.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I use rotisserie chicken?
Yes. Simply shred the chicken and mix it with the honey BBQ sauce.
Can I make these ahead?
Yes. Prepare the chicken a day in advance and assemble the tacos before serving.
What cheese works best?
Mozzarella, Monterey Jack, cheddar, or pepper jack all taste great.
Can I freeze the chicken?
Yes. Freeze the cooked BBQ chicken for up to 3 months.
